  5. Plays Metallica, Vol. 2 -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Plays_Metallica,_Vol._2

    Plays Metallica, Vol. 2 is the tenth studio album by Finnish Cello metal band Apocalyptica, released on 7 June 2024. [5] It is their second full cover album and a sequel to Plays Metallica by Four Cellos (1996).

  6. Apocalyptica (album)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Apocalyptica_(album)

    Apocalyptica is the fifth studio album by the Finnish symphonic metal band of same name.Although Mikko Sirén has been with Apocalyptica two years prior to this release, he was not an official member of the band until after this release, but this is still his first release with the band along with the band having a drummer for their first time.

  7. Worlds Collide (Apocalyptica album)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Worlds_Collide...

    Worlds Collide is the sixth studio album from Finnish classical band, Apocalyptica. While this album is the sixth major release, it is also (including singles, videos, box sets, etc.) the twenty-eighth release overall.
